About Modulus

Modulus - about the game

Modulus stands out as a factory simulation game that emphasizes creativity and efficiency in a serene environment. This PC title invites players to construct intricate production lines using customizable modules, blending elements of puzzle-solving and strategic planning without the stress of combat or deadlines.

Gameplay

In Modulus, the core experience revolves around designing and automating factories with modular components. Players start by harvesting basic resources and use tools to cut, paint, stamp, and assemble 3D modules that form the backbone of production systems. These modules serve as both resources and structural elements, visible in the growing factory layouts.

The game encourages optimization through logistical challenges, where scaling production unlocks new mechanics like advanced tools and complex designs. Factories operate on a grid system, allowing for precise placement of conveyor belts and machines. A day-night cycle adds a subtle rhythm to building sessions, while features like undo and redo support experimentation without frustration.

Story elements weave in as players, initially programmed to supply bots for a colony, respond to a mysterious signal by constructing massive Neural Monuments. This narrative drives progression, pushing for increasingly elaborate automation strategies that reward both functional efficiency and aesthetic appeal.

Game Modes

Modulus features two primary ways to engage with its systems. The main mode presents a progressive campaign with clear objectives, guiding players through building upon previously mastered modules to meet escalating demands, such as creating bots and erecting monuments.

Creative Mode removes all restrictions, providing unlimited resources, expanded module sizes, and full tool access. Here, the focus shifts to pure invention, whether testing layouts, crafting voxel art, or exploring wild ideas on an open grid without any goals or pressures.

Key Features and Mechanics

Beyond basic assembly, Modulus includes a minimap for navigation and an updated tutorial that eases newcomers into its logic-driven puzzles. Recent improvements have enhanced performance and added quality-of-life elements, making it smoother to iterate on designs.

Resource management ties into a skill progression system, where accumulating points from efficient production allows unlocks that deepen strategic options. The absence of threats creates a relaxing space for thoughtful play, ideal for those who enjoy refining systems over time.

Minimum:

  • OS: Windows 10 - 64 bit
  • Processor: Intel Core i5-11600K / AMD Ryzen 5 5500
  • Memory: 16 GB RAM
  • Graphics: Nvidia GeForce GTX 1660 / AMD Radeon RX 590
  • DirectX: Version 11
  • Storage: 5 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: Sufficient for large factories in 30 fps.

Recommended:

  • OS: Windows 10 - 64 bit
  • Processor: Intel Core i5-12600K / AMD Ryzen 5 5600X
  • Memory: 16 GB RAM
  • Graphics: Geforce RTX 3060 / Radeon RX 6600 XT
  • DirectX: Version 11
  • Storage: 5 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: Sufficient for large factories in 60 fps.
